I have played both and near the end of Metaphor. Both have set stories, but I feel that there is better character building in Metaphor, the stories you go along with your companions on. It is (to me) a better version of Persona 5. Unlocking different classes is not as convulted. You can really create the party how you want.

My biggest complaint about persona 5 was that I never had enough MP to cast spells in the larger dungeons...Metaphor has a work around, kind of (basically have the main character be a mage archetype and run around killing things on the map...get powerful enough and you do not hav to go through the whole fight).

The story (Metaphor) is heavy handed politically (especially from U.S. perspective) so that might turn off a few people. More surprises with Metaphor, but then again I played the original FF7 and not one of those people that recalls everything from a 27 year old game.

Enjoyed both, but with Rebirth, the longer I played the more I was like..ok are we killing Aerith now? How about now? Oh wait, not yet? Now? Was slightly exhausting. I also do not care for being utterly confused at the end of an 100 hour game like I was with Rebirth (and no sense reading about it because I will have forgotten everything by the time part 3 comes out)...course I have not completed Metaphor and Persona 5 really went off the rails in the last 30 minutes (I can not stnad the ending and my son (21) is like come on dad it was epic...damn kids)

Also felt like Metaphor battles are more tactical whereas in Rebirth I kind of simply strong armed my way through them.
